> I'm working on building a corpus of Uygur texts and some of the content is 
> coming from pdf files. I wrote a short python script to scrape text from pdf 
> using tika-python. The script is Arabic, and the output looks good but there 
> is one major problem: there are many missing spaces between words and I 
> really do not know how to address this issue. I am attaching a pdf file, the 
> script to scrape its text and the output (test_scraped.utf8). Thanks in 
> advance for your help.
